Hinneberg


From on Thu, 16 Sep 2004

I came across your site some time ago and have found it a very useful source of information.
I thought I should send you some information to correct a minor error re the Hinneberg family on the Diggelman page where the sister of Frederick and Christophe, Rosina Wilhelmina Hinneberg, wed Wilhelm Gottfried Ferdinand Eltze, and their daughter Louise Friderike Eltze wed August Johann Diggelmann.

It appears the Hinneberg family did not arrive in Australia on the ship Leontine (as is stated in a number of sources), Rather they arrived (in Melbourne) Oct 1854 on the Malvina Vidal with their mother (Marie Christiane Lehmann my GGG Aunt) and stepfather (Adolf Berkholz). Marie seems to have died soon after arrival on the Hinneberg. Children became wards of their Uncle Johann Gottlieb. Adolf Berkholz remarried on 1 July 1856 to Elizabeth Richards and registered 2 dau in Victoria, Edith 1869 and Alice 1872.

See web page Malvina Vidal immigrants wrongly thought Adelaide was 10 miles west of Melbourne, not 350 English miles as they discovered on arrival
From Port Phillip Herald, Fri 6 Oct 1854, Page 4, Malvina Vidal arrived 5 Oct, a Dutch ship 959 tons from Hamburg 11 July, with 277 steerage passengers and 3 named as Cabin passengers for Melbourne.
According to the official passenger list, 254 Germans and Wends disembarked at Melbourne, the remaining passengers and cargo including a number of German shepherds specially recruited for the Australian Agricultural Company in New South Wales, plus 26 Saxon merino rams, 26 Saxon merino ewes, ten Mecklenberg ewes and three sheepdogs, bound for New South Wales. On 12 October 1854, most of the Wends boarded the coastal steamer Havilah at Coles' Wharf and left Melbourne for Adelaide, where they arrived four days later. From his Naturalisation Certificate, Friederich Hinneberg is 22 years of age ... In 1853 arrived by the ship Malvina Kidal from the Port of Hamburg at Melbourne and proceeded by steamer to Port Adelaide and in 1856 came overland back to Victoria - Sworn on 24 Sept 1860 he was a Farmer in Victoria.
